Prince Alfred was born #OTD in 1844. Queen Victoria's 2nd son, Prince Alfred, had an enquiring mind & reportedly taught himself the violin when he was a child. William Ross’s paintings of the royal children were made as gifts from Prince Albert to Queen Victoria.

Do you have what it takes to climb the steps to the top of the Round Tower at #WindsorCastle? The stone steps at the entrance have hardly changed since this photo was taken in around 1890. The view from the top will be worth the effort! bit.ly/45nybb4
